Transaction 377a93e5895042283dd63524d76101d0073fc6476d98e2d9248a78e4b86b81c4
1 Input
2 Outputs
- 377a93e5895042283dd63524d76101d0073fc6476d98e2d9248a78e4b86b81c4:0
- 377a93e5895042283dd63524d76101d0073fc6476d98e2d9248a78e4b86b81c4:1
value 12044824
address 1EWi69Qy9DDGeg3Gs7Z6V1FtPHE8sPdoiR
value 4243320
address 15HfBM7RyfPMvX6kFCf48bAhn75L6e9h1A